At the core of human motivation is dopamine, a neurotransmitter that plays a pivotal role in reward processing. It governs our desires and pleasures, influencing behaviors associated with goal-directed activities. Conditions such as Restless Legs Syndrome and attention deficit hyperactivity disorder (ADHD) are linked to decreased dopamine activity, underscoring the significance of this neurotransmitter in maintaining focus and motivation. Understanding how dopamine operates not only sheds light on human behavior but also provides valuable insights into designing AI systems that effectively engage users.
The relationship between “wanting” and “liking” in addiction exemplifies how dopamine influences our interactions with rewards. In drug addiction, the initial pleasure derived from substance use diminishes over time as tolerance develops, while the desire to consume the drug can persist or even increase. This dissociation between wanting and liking highlights a critical aspect of reward—while all pleasurable experiences are rewarding, not all rewards elicit pleasure. This distinction is crucial for AI designers striving to create systems that maintain user engagement without falling into the traps of diminishing returns.
In the realm of HCI, the focus shifts to how users engage with AI systems. As we learn to navigate mixed-initiative interfaces, where humans and AI collaborate, understanding the principles of interaction becomes essential. Effective HCI design requires acknowledging the fundamental challenges users face when dealing with imperfect automation. By incorporating principles like direct manipulation and cooperative AI systems, designers can create interfaces that resonate with users' intrinsic motivations—essentially leveraging the dopamine reward system to foster positive interactions.
For instance, a mixed-initiative AI system can be designed to adapt based on user feedback, enhancing its performance and responsiveness. By aligning the AI’s capabilities with the user's needs and preferences, the system can create a rewarding experience that encourages continued interaction. This synergy between human motivation and AI functionality is crucial for maximizing user satisfaction and engagement.
Here are three actionable strategies to enhance human-AI interaction:
-
Implement Feedback Loops: Create systems that allow for user feedback to refine AI performance. By incorporating user suggestions and preferences, AI can better align with individual motivations, making interactions more rewarding and personalized.
-
Design for Imperfection: Acknowledge the limitations of AI and design interfaces that empower users to understand and manage these imperfections. Providing clear guidance on how to interact with AI systems can alleviate frustration and enhance the overall user experience.
-
Utilize Gamification Techniques: Integrate elements of gamification into AI interactions to stimulate dopamine release and maintain user engagement. Features such as progress tracking, rewards for achievements, and interactive challenges can transform mundane tasks into enjoyable experiences.
